While returning to Duluth from milder weather in the Twin Cities on Saturday Nov. 29th the roads quickly became slick and dangerous, a three car pile up in the northbound lane of I-35 where the CN railroad bridge crosses over, snarled traffic for over an hour that left a few drivers with wrecked vehicles and a traffic jam that couldn't of come at a worse time as the record crowd attending the Snocross event at Spirit Mtn were wrapping up that event. I did not see a single snow plow/sander throughout the entire drive on the interstate.
